Prisoner of Echo provides players with an exciting journey navigating mines and using sound waves to unlock doors and hide from enemies. The story is compelling and the gameplay is interesting, but I feel like more could have been done to educate the player on principles of sound waves. The player picks a sound sample, frequency, and amplitude to match the requirements of the door they are trying to open, but the game depends on players to study the changing wave shape as they adjust values to deduce the actual principles at work.
